# Constants for the Pelicant event schema registry, flagged for this
# week's eng sync. Quick recap: producers fetch schemas on publish and
# cache them locally, so registry load is mostly cold-start spikes plus
# compatibility checks on deploys. We saw cache stampedes last Tuesday
# when the Ardmore cluster rolled, hence the jittered TTLs below.
# Nothing here is load-bearing for correctness, just latency and
# politeness. Adjust with care and ping the sync thread first. Current
# values follow.

constants for bawif-kawif:
QUOTAS = {
    "ulaael": 5,
    "holael": 10,
}

Ticket: KVGUARD-233 — Bloom filter bypassed on staging (env drift)

Flagging this for security review: the bloom filter in front of the Cragstone KV store isn't loading on staging, so every lookup hits the store directly — nice little amplification risk if someone hammers us with misses. Root cause is embarrassing: the env rebuild last sprint dropped the filter service's auth var, and the sidecar fails open instead of closed (separate ticket for that). To restore the filter, the env file needs this line added back:

sealed setting: VAULT_KEY20=69e2a0b23f1a79fbf692

TURN-208: Gatevale turnstile counters at the Merrow Field pilot double-count when a rotation reverses mid-cycle. Attendance totals drift roughly 2% high per event. The debounce window fix is implemented, reviewed by Ilsa, and soak-tested across two simulated match days without drift. Ready for your cut; the candidate build is identified below.

trace token, tagag-tafog: htk6_5ed18c